Watch, Follow, &
Connect with Us

Please visit our new home
community.embarcadero.com.


Welcome, Guest
Guest Settings
Help

Thread: Splitterの表示が異常なのですが・・・



Permlink Replies: 4 - Last Post: Jan 10, 2018 7:14 PM Last Post By: osamu nagao
osamu nagao

Posts: 8
Registered: 2/10/18
Splitterの表示が異常なのですが・・・
Click to report abuse...   Click to reply to this thread Reply
  Posted: Jan 9, 2018 8:59 PM
nagaoです。いつもお世話頂きありがとうございます。
Delphi 10.1 Berlinで作成した私のソフトのフォームに貼り付けてあるTSlplitterの
インスタンスであるSplitter1は、実行時に殆ど期待どおり動作するのですが、
マウスをそこへ持っていっても、←│→のマークが表示されません。
←│→のマークが表示されるようにする対策を教えて頂けませんでしょうか?

なお、【ファイル】-【新規作成】-【VCLアプリケーション】で作成した新プロジェクトでは
このような不具合はなく、←│→のマークが表示されます。

また、上記の新プロジェクトに張り付けたるSplitterのプロパティと同じように、
私のソフトのフォームに貼り付けてSplitterのプロパティを変えてみたのですが、
それでも←│→のマークが表示されません。
igy kk

Posts: 150
Registered: 9/11/03
Re: Splitterの表示が異常なのですが・・・
Click to report abuse...   Click to reply to this thread Reply
  Posted: Jan 9, 2018 9:22 PM   in response to: osamu nagao in response to: osamu nagao
nagaoさんのソフトで、Screen.Cursor プロパティ とか、
フォームに貼り付けているSplitterのCursor プロパティなどは、
コード上で何か指定していますか?
osamu nagao

Posts: 8
Registered: 2/10/18
Re: Splitterの表示が異常なのですが・・・
Click to report abuse...   Click to reply to this thread Reply
  Posted: Jan 10, 2018 1:29 PM   in response to: igy kk in response to: igy kk
igy kk さん、こんにちは。nagaoです。
レスくださいましてありがとうございます。
わたしのソフトでは、コード上のあちこちで
  Screen.Cursor=crArrow;
とか
  Screen.Cursor=crHourGlass;
などと指示しています。

SplitterのCursor プロパティはcrHSplitのままで
コード上では指定していません。
igy kk

Posts: 150
Registered: 9/11/03
Re: Splitterの表示が異常なのですが・・・
Click to report abuse...   Click to reply to this thread Reply
  Posted: Jan 10, 2018 2:25 PM   in response to: osamu nagao in response to: osamu nagao
osamu nagao wrote:
わたしのソフトでは、コード上のあちこちで
  Screen.Cursor=crArrow;
とか
  Screen.Cursor=crHourGlass;
などと指示しています。

それらは、デフォルトの crDefault に戻す箇所はありますか?

Vcl.Forms.TScreen.Cursor
http://docwiki.embarcadero.com/Libraries/Tokyo/ja/Vcl.Forms.TScreen.Cursor
の「説明」が参考になるかと・・
osamu nagao

Posts: 8
Registered: 2/10/18
Re: Splitterの表示が異常なのですが・・・
Click to report abuse...   Click to reply to this thread Reply
  Posted: Jan 10, 2018 7:14 PM   in response to: igy kk in response to: igy kk
igy kkさん、こんにちは。nagaoです。
デフォルトの crDefault に戻す箇所を設けたら、←││→が表示されるように
なりました。

ありがとうございました。
Legend
Helpful Answer (5 pts)
Correct Answer (10 pts)

Server Response from: ETNAJIVE02